More than 80 teenagers have benefited from PESCAR program


The program includes 350 hours of basic electricity classes and the same for citizenship activities, including education in environmental health and safety, financial administration, training in English and computer skills.

Some complementary training sessions help them to face drugs, sexuality and aggressions in a responsible way. Students also benefit in workshops to encourage teamwork and acceptable social behaviour.

The project is fully supported by AREVA T&D Brazil employees volunteering their time to teach some classes or help the trainees' orientation.

Many company suppliers of the Group have committed themselves becoming full or partial sponsors. Meals, transportation, life insurance, uniforms, tools for the electricity activities are sponsored partially or totally by some AREVA partners.
